// Copyright (C) 2016 The Qt Company Ltd.
// SPDX-License-Identifier: LicenseRef-Qt-Commercial OR GPL-3.0-only WITH Qt-GPL-exception-1.0
#include <extensionsystem/pluginmanager.h>
#include <extensionsystem/pluginspec.h>
#include <extensionsystem/iplugin.h>
#include <utils/qtcsettings_p.h>
#include <QObject>
#include <QSignalSpy>
#include <QTest>
using namespace ExtensionSystem;
using namespace Utils;
using namespace Utils::Internal;
class SignalReceiver;
class tst_PluginManager : public QObject
{
Q_OBJECT
private slots:
void init();
void cleanup();
void addRemoveObjects();
void getObject();
void circularPlugins();
void correctPlugins1();
private:
PluginManager *m_pm;
QSignalSpy *m_objectAdded;
QSignalSpy *m_aboutToRemoveObject;
QSignalSpy *m_pluginsChanged;
};
class MyClass1 : public QObject
{
Q_OBJECT
};
class MyClass2 : public QObject
{
Q_OBJECT
};
class MyClass11 : public MyClass1
{
Q_OBJECT
};
static Utils::FilePath pluginFolder(const QLatin1String &folder)
{
return Utils::FilePath::fromUserInput(QLatin1String(PLUGINMANAGER_TESTS_DIR)) / folder;
}
void tst_PluginManager::init()
{
m_pm = new PluginManager;
SettingsSetup::setupSettings(new QtcSettings, new QtcSettings);
PluginManager::setPluginIID(QLatin1String("plugin"));
m_objectAdded = new QSignalSpy(m_pm, &PluginManager::objectAdded);
m_aboutToRemoveObject = new QSignalSpy(m_pm, &PluginManager::aboutToRemoveObject);
m_pluginsChanged = new QSignalSpy(m_pm, &PluginManager::pluginsChanged);
}
void tst_PluginManager::cleanup()
{
PluginManager::shutdown();
SettingsSetup::destroySettings();
delete m_pm;
delete m_objectAdded;
delete m_aboutToRemoveObject;
delete m_pluginsChanged;
}
void tst_PluginManager::addRemoveObjects()
{
QObject *object1 = new QObject;
QObject *object2 = new QObject;
QCOMPARE(PluginManager::allObjects().size(), 0);
PluginManager::addObject(object1);
QCOMPARE(m_objectAdded->count(), 1);
QCOMPARE(m_objectAdded->at(0).first().value<QObject *>(), object1);
QCOMPARE(m_aboutToRemoveObject->count(), 0);
QVERIFY(PluginManager::allObjects().contains(object1));
QVERIFY(!PluginManager::allObjects().contains(object2));
QCOMPARE(PluginManager::allObjects().size(), 1);
PluginManager::addObject(object2);
QCOMPARE(m_objectAdded->count(), 2);
QCOMPARE(m_objectAdded->at(1).first().value<QObject *>(), object2);
QCOMPARE(m_aboutToRemoveObject->count(), 0);
QVERIFY(PluginManager::allObjects().contains(object1));
QVERIFY(PluginManager::allObjects().contains(object2));
QCOMPARE(PluginManager::allObjects().size(), 2);
PluginManager::removeObject(object1);
QCOMPARE(m_objectAdded->count(), 2);
QCOMPARE(m_aboutToRemoveObject->count(), 1);
QCOMPARE(m_aboutToRemoveObject->at(0).first().value<QObject *>(), object1);
QVERIFY(!PluginManager::allObjects().contains(object1));
QVERIFY(PluginManager::allObjects().contains(object2));
QCOMPARE(PluginManager::allObjects().size(), 1);
PluginManager::removeObject(object2);
QCOMPARE(m_objectAdded->count(), 2);
QCOMPARE(m_aboutToRemoveObject->count(), 2);
QCOMPARE(m_aboutToRemoveObject->at(1).first().value<QObject *>(), object2);
QVERIFY(!PluginManager::allObjects().contains(object1));
QVERIFY(!PluginManager::allObjects().contains(object2));
QCOMPARE(PluginManager::allObjects().size(), 0);
delete object1;
delete object2;
}
void tst_PluginManager::getObject()
{
MyClass2 *object2 = new MyClass2;
MyClass11 *object11 = new MyClass11;
MyClass2 *object2b = new MyClass2;
const QString objectName = QLatin1String("OBJECTNAME");
object2b->setObjectName(objectName);
PluginManager::addObject(object2);
QCOMPARE(PluginManager::getObject<MyClass11>(), static_cast<MyClass11 *>(0));
QCOMPARE(PluginManager::getObject<MyClass1>(), static_cast<MyClass1 *>(0));
QCOMPARE(PluginManager::getObject<MyClass2>(), object2);
PluginManager::addObject(object11);
QCOMPARE(PluginManager::getObject<MyClass11>(), object11);
QCOMPARE(PluginManager::getObject<MyClass1>(), qobject_cast<MyClass1 *>(object11));
QCOMPARE(PluginManager::getObject<MyClass2>(), object2);
QCOMPARE(PluginManager::getObjectByName(objectName), static_cast<QObject *>(0));
PluginManager::addObject(object2b);
QCOMPARE(PluginManager::getObjectByName(objectName), object2b);
QCOMPARE(PluginManager::getObject<MyClass2>(
[&objectName](MyClass2 *obj) { return obj->objectName() == objectName;}), object2b);
PluginManager::removeObject(object2);
PluginManager::removeObject(object11);
PluginManager::removeObject(object2b);
delete object2;
delete object11;
delete object2b;
}
void tst_PluginManager::circularPlugins()
{
PluginManager::setPluginPaths({pluginFolder(QLatin1String("circularplugins"))});
PluginManager::loadPlugins();
const PluginSpecs plugins = PluginManager::plugins();
QCOMPARE(plugins.count(), 3);
for (PluginSpec *spec : plugins) {
if (spec->id() == "plugin1") {
QVERIFY(spec->hasError());
QCOMPARE(spec->state(), PluginSpec::Resolved);
QCOMPARE(spec->plugin(), static_cast<IPlugin *>(0));
} else if (spec->id() == "plugin2") {
QVERIFY2(!spec->hasError(), qPrintable(spec->errorString()));
QCOMPARE(spec->state(), PluginSpec::Running);
} else if (spec->id() == "plugin3") {
QVERIFY(spec->hasError());
QCOMPARE(spec->state(), PluginSpec::Resolved);
QCOMPARE(spec->plugin(), static_cast<IPlugin *>(0));
}
}
}
void tst_PluginManager::correctPlugins1()
{
PluginManager::setPluginPaths({pluginFolder(QLatin1String("correctplugins1"))});
PluginManager::loadPlugins();
bool specError = false;
bool runError = false;
const PluginSpecs plugins = PluginManager::plugins();
for (PluginSpec *spec : plugins) {
if (spec->hasError()) {
qDebug() << spec->filePath();
qDebug() << spec->errorString();
}
specError = specError || spec->hasError();
runError = runError || (spec->state() != PluginSpec::Running);
}
QVERIFY(!specError);
QVERIFY(!runError);
bool plugin1running = false;
bool plugin2running = false;
bool plugin3running = false;
const QList<QObject *> objs = PluginManager::allObjects();
for (QObject *obj : objs) {
if (obj->objectName() == "MyPlugin1_running")
plugin1running = true;
else if (obj->objectName() == "MyPlugin2_running")
plugin2running = true;
else if (obj->objectName() == "MyPlugin3_running")
plugin3running = true;
}
QVERIFY(plugin1running);
QVERIFY(plugin2running);
QVERIFY(plugin3running);
}
QTEST_GUILESS_MAIN(tst_PluginManager)
#include "tst_pluginmanager.moc"
